Eighteenth Brumaire
The event on November 9, 1799, by the French Revolutionary calendar (Brumaire 18), when Napoleon Bonaparte overthrew the French government, establishing himself as the First Consul and leading to his eventual dictatorship.
Louis Napoleon
Napoleon III, the nephew of Napoleon Bonaparte, who became the first President of France and then Emperor, leading France during significant industrial expansion in the 19th century.
Karl Marx
A German philosopher, economist, and socialist revolutionary whose works, including the Communist Manifesto, laid the foundation for the theory and practice of communism.
